Two Ten’s Women In Footwear Industry (WIFI) Announces A New Northwest Chapter

First Inaugural meeting on, December 11, 2013

Location: Fit Right, 2258 NW Raleigh Street, Portland from 6:30 pm to 8:30 pm

Lake Oswego, Oregon, November 8, 2013–

Two Ten Women in Footwear Industry (WIFI) announce their pilot meeting on Wednesday, December 11th at Fit Right on 2258 NW Raleigh St. in Portland from 6:30 pm to 8:30 pm. Two Ten is partnering with National Shoe Travelers for this inaugural event.

Two Ten WIFI began in 2010 with small groups of woman meeting after work and has grown to hundreds of participants in 7 cities across the country: Las Vegas, Los Angeles, Milwaukee, Boston New York, Columbus and St. Louis. Each group will hold an average of 2 events per year. The group is chaired by Diane Sullivan, President and CEO of Brown Shoe Company and Carol Baiocchi, VP-DMM at Kohl’s Department Stores. The events consist of an educational as well as networking component. Discussion topics include mentoring, negotiation, entrepreneurship and work life balance.

About Two Ten Footwear Foundation

Founded in 1939, Two Ten is the footwear industry’s national charitable foundation. We are committed to strengthening the footwear community by providing emergency financial relief for times of crisis, college scholarships, counseling, support and information and referral services to those in need.

ABOUT NATIONAL SHOE TRAVELERS

Founded in 2006, National Shoe Travelers, formerly known WSA (2006), is a membership organization whose goals are to represent and to significantly improve the abilities and well-being of traveling sales representatives who work within the footwear and related goods industry. NST’s primarily activities include providing its members with information, life insurance benefits, education and networking opportunities with fellow members, vendors and other key players in the footwear industry.
